A council housing company has been threatened with dissolution for failing to file its accounts on time. Luton Borough Council’s company, Foxhall Homes, was hit with a ‘first Gazette’ notice by Companies House. It blamed the delay on the pandemic and said it failed to inform Companies House because of an “administrative error”. The company’s accounts for 2019/20 are now more than seven months overdue, with no financial results filed since October 2019. Read more on Inside Housing.
